1、在fiddler中启用Rules → Performances → Simulate Modem Speeds :模拟调制解调器的速度
2、在开启第一步模拟调制解调器的速度功能前,应该去设置我们需要模拟的网速,Rules→ Customize Rules,点击该选项后会出现一个文本编辑框,在这段文本内我们只需要修改其中一段代码就可以
网络取值的算法就是 1000/下载速度 = 需要delay的时间(毫秒),比如50kb/s 需要delay20毫秒来接收数据。
查找下面的代码,设置好你想要模拟的网速:
if (m_SimulateModem) {
// Delay sends by 300ms per KB uploaded. //每延迟300ms发送1kb的数据,也就是每1s发送10/3kb的数据
oSession["request-trickle-delay"] = "300";
// Delay receives by 150ms per KB downloaded.//每延迟150ms下行1kb的数据
oSession["response-trickle-delay"] &#